IsoDAR@Yemilab: Preliminary Design Report -- Volume II: Medium Energy Beam Transport, Neutrino Source, and Shielding

Abstract

This Preliminary Design Report (PDR) describes the IsoDAR electron-antineutrino source in two volumes which are mostly site-independent and describe the cyclotron driver providing a 60 MeV, 10 mA proton beam (Volume I); and the medium energy beam transport line (MEBT) and target (this Volume). The IsoDAR driver and target will produce about 1.15·1023 electron-antineutrinos over five calendar years. Paired with a kton-scale liquid scintillator detector, this will enable a broad particle physics program including searches for new symmetries, new interactions and new particles. Here in Volume II, we describe the medium energy beam transport line, the antineutrino source beam-target and surrounding sleeve, shielding, and plans for monitoring and installation.
